How to Be Successful Selling on Poshmark
In today’s digital age, online marketplaces have become a popular platform for individuals to sell their unwanted items and make a profit. One such platform is Poshmark, a mobile app that allows users to buy and sell clothing, accessories, and home decor. If you’re looking to maximize your earnings on Poshmark, here are some tips to help you become successful.
1. Curate Your Inventory
The key to success on Poshmark is to have a curated inventory that appeals to your target audience. Research the latest trends and identify items that are in high demand. Look for items that are in good condition and have a high resale value. By focusing on quality and popularity, you’ll attract more buyers and increase your sales.
2. Take High-Quality Photos
In the world of online shopping, first impressions matter. Make sure to take high-quality, well-lit photos of your items. Use a natural background and a variety of angles to showcase the item’s details. This will help potential buyers visualize the product and make a more informed decision.
3. Write Detailed Descriptions
A detailed description is essential for selling on Poshmark. Include information about the item’s size, color, material, and any unique features. Be honest about any flaws or wear and tear, as this will build trust with your buyers. The more information you provide, the better your chances of making a sale.
4. Use Hashtags and Tags Wisely
Hashtags and tags are powerful tools on Poshmark that can help you reach a wider audience. Use relevant hashtags and tags to categorize your items and make them more discoverable. However, avoid overusing hashtags, as this can come across as spammy.
5. Engage with Your Audience
Engaging with your audience is crucial for building a loyal customer base. Respond promptly to messages and comments, and show appreciation for your buyers. Follow other sellers and participate in Poshmark events to increase your visibility and network with fellow sellers.
6. Offer Competitive Pricing
Price your items competitively to attract buyers. Research the market and compare similar items to determine a fair price. Keep in mind that you can always lower your price if you’re not getting any interest, but avoid selling your items at a loss.
7. Provide Excellent Customer Service
Excellent customer service is essential for repeat business and positive reviews. Be responsive to any issues or concerns your buyers may have. Offer a refund or exchange policy if necessary, and ensure that your buyers have a positive experience from start to finish.
